Inconsistency between data written to multipath device and read from underlying paths

Solution Verified - Updated -

Issue

When testing the performance of a multipathed SAN storage array, data written to one device is not updated on the others even through they should all be the same data store.

If data is written to /dev/mapper/mpath1, then read from /dev/sdb, the updated data is not there. Similarly, writing to /dev/sdb and reading from /dev/sdc does not show the updated data.

Environment

  • Red Hat Enterprise Linux
  • device-mapper-multipath
  • SAN storage
